Our Service:

The Head to Health service is a brand new service for adults in Western Sydney seeking emotional wellbeing and mental health support. The service provides a combination of peer-led recovery and clinical support and a safe, welcoming and supportive environment for people experiencing psychological distress. Allowing low risk individuals to identify alternatives to presenting to the Emergency Department and gaining access support from trained mental health professional within their community, outside a clinical setting.

Role Overview:

  • Provide regular, flexible, low level non-clinical support to service users, and assist them to review their needs and resources, monitor activities identified in client Support Plans.
  • Enable clients to achieve independence as far as possible in all areas of their life by providing appropriate information, opportunity, training and support
  • Routinely perform Outcome Measures, and other data collection.
  • Effective use of Supportability including self-management of rosters, record time and sign off of client activity, input journal entries and case notes.
  • Provide support (that is sensitive, client focused and community orientated), advocacy and information to our clients with the use of the recovery process
  • Attendance and participation in Communities of Practice, professional development and Critical incident management activities.


Requirements:

  • Minimum of a Cert IV in a Community services related discipline (ideally a completed Bachelors or Diploma).
  • To have experienced a mental illness which is now under effective management or lived experience of caring for someone having gone through mental illness.
  • Knowledge and understanding of the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islanders Culture and the ability to communicate effectively and sensitively with Indigenous Clients.
  • Experience, skills and knowledge in working with people experiencing mental illness.
  • Understanding of and ability to apply the principles of a recovery-oriented, person-centered, and strengths-based approach to service delivery.
  • Ability to implement and facilitate capacity building activities with participants.
  • Ability to demonstrate initiative and work independently.
  • Capacity to collaborate within a multidisciplinary team across a range of organisations.
  • Must be eligible to apply/currently hold a WWCC
  • Must hold/be willing to apply for NDIS worker screening clearance
  • Current driver's licence with a good driving history and a registered, well maintained vehicle that is available to be used for the purposes of this role.
